In an engaging user forum discussion, participants reflect on their experiences with extended shifts to alternate realities. As one user prepares for a long-term shift, the topic prompts others to share their own experiences, revealing varying perspectives and emotions surrounding this phenomenon.

Extended Shifts: A Common Experience

The conversation centers around the concept of permashifting, a term referring to prolonged experiences in alternate realities. Users discuss both fear and excitement regarding these shifts. One user mentioned their longest shift lasted five years, while another claimed to have gained memories spanning twenty years within just a few days.

"My longest shift has been for five years," sharing one user who primarily shifts to the year 2023.

The blending of perception and reality seems to play a significant role in these experiences. One participant described a four-day conscious shift that felt like two decades due to the intensity of memories they accessed.
